Morris West 1916-99
Article Abstract:
A look at the career and works of Melbourne born author Morris West after his sudden death on October 8, 1999. Contributions include his percipience in subject-matter choices, making his works topically relevant.

A Miller's tale
Article Abstract:
Australian author Alex Miller, who appears at the Melbourne Writers' Festival in September 2000, has received critical acclaim for his book "Conditions of Faith" published in 2000.
